San Juan del Sur, Nicaragua

Admired for it’s tumbling Pacific surf and crescent shaped bay of golden sand dunes, this former fishing hamlet has undergone something of a renaissance. Having managed to retain its easy-going charm, San Juan del Sur is consistently popular with surfers and those seeking relatively peaceful beaches without all the unnecessary tourist developments attached.

Aside from surfing and dozing in hammocks, the Pacific Ocean hosts allsorts of sea based activities from sailing to deep sea fishing, while the backdrop of forested peaks can be explored by foot or on horseback. Furthermore, the coast is lined with many deserted beaches worthy of a visit, including Playa Marsella and Playa El Coco. The sweeping cove and tropical dry forest of Playa La Flor, situated just beyond Playa El Coco, is protected by a wildlife refuge. Between August and November, the beach is swarmed by thousands of Olive Ridley turtles who brave the shores to lay eggs, while the northern tip is besieged at sunset by a migration of hermit crabs.
